深圳实时数据API挖掘

时间:2024年02月19日 来源:

处理API数据中的数据合并和关联操作可以帮助开发人员实现API的数据整合和数据分析。以下是一些常见的处理方法:数据合并:数据合并是一种数据处理方法,可以将多个数据源的数据合并为一个数据集。开发人员可以使用数据合并来处理API数据中的多个数据源和数据格式,以实现API的数据整合和数据分析。具体来说,开发人员可以使用数据合并工具,将API数据中的多个数据源的数据合并为一个数据集,以便于API的数据处理和分析。数据关联:数据关联是一种数据处理方法,可以将多个数据源的数据关联起来,以实现API的数据整合和数据分析。开发人员可以使用数据关联来处理API数据中的多个数据源和数据格式,以实现API的数据整合和数据分析。具体来说,开发人员可以使用数据关联工具,将API数据中的多个数据源的数据关联起来,以便于API的数据处理和分析。API数据用于创建即时通讯和聊天应用程序,提供实时的消息传递和聊天功能。深圳实时数据API挖掘

深圳实时数据API挖掘,API数据

处理API数据中的消息格式和协议转换通常涉及将数据从一种格式或协议转换为另一种格式或协议,以满足不同系统之间的需求和兼容性。下面是一些常见的方法和技术,用于处理API数据中的消息格式和协议转换:序列化和反序列化:序列化是将数据从一种结构化格式(如对象、JSON、XML)转换为字节流的过程,而反序列化是将字节流转换回原始数据格式的过程。在API通信中,常见的序列化格式包括JSON、XML和Protocol Buffers等。通过序列化和反序列化,可以在不同系统之间传输和解析数据。数据转换和映射:对于不同的系统和应用程序,可能使用不同的数据模型和结构。在API数据转换过程中,需要进行数据转换和映射,将一个数据模型转换为另一个数据模型。这可以通过手动编写转换逻辑或使用转换工具库(如Jackson、Gson、Automapper等)来实现。消息格式转换:当不同系统使用不同的消息格式(如JSON、XML、CSV)进行通信时,需要进行消息格式的转换。可以使用相应的转换库或工具来实现消息格式之间的转换。例如,使用JSON和XML转换库来处理JSON和XML之间的转换。深圳实时数据API挖掘API数据的质量和准确性对于应用程序的正常运行和用户体验至关重要。

深圳实时数据API挖掘,API数据

处理API数据中的并发更新和不和解决是确保数据一致性和可靠性的重要步骤。下面是一些常见的方法和技术,可用于处理API数据中的并发更新和不和解决:乐观并发控制:采用乐观并发控制机制,允许多个用户同时对数据进行更新操作,但在提交更改时检查数据是否被其他用户修改过。常见的乐观并发控制方法包括使用版本号、时间戳或哈希值等来跟踪数据的变化,并在提交更改时比较这些标识来检测不和。悲观并发控制:采用悲观并发控制机制,通过锁定数据资源来阻止并发更新。当一个用户正在对数据进行更新时,其他用户必须等待该用户完成操作后才能进行更新。悲观并发控制可以使用数据库锁或分布式锁等技术来实现。事务处理:使用事务处理来确保数据的一致性和完整性。事务是一组操作的逻辑单元,要么全部执行成功,要么全部回滚。在并发更新时,将相关的操作放在一个事务中,以确保它们以原子方式执行,从而避免数据不和和不一致性。

实现API数据中的多语言支持和国际化通常涉及以下几个方面的考虑:多语言资源管理:首先,需要管理多语言资源,包括文本翻译、语言文件和本地化资源。可以使用国际化资源管理工具或框架(如gettext、i18next、Java ResourceBundle等)来组织和管理多语言资源。语言选择和区域设置:在API通信中,客户端通常会提供先选语言或区域设置的信息,以指示其所需的语言。可以通过请求头或查询参数等方式传递这些信息。服务端可以根据这些信息来确定使用哪种语言的资源进行响应。文本翻译:对于需要翻译的文本,可以使用机器翻译服务(如Google Translate、Microsoft Translator)或人工翻译来生成多语言版本。翻译后的文本可以存储在语言文件或数据库中,并在需要时进行加载和使用。动态文本替换:在API响应中,可能存在需要动态替换的文本,如日期、时间、数字等。为了支持多语言,可以使用占位符或模板变量来表示这些动态文本,并在生成响应时根据语言选择进行替换。开发人员使用API数据创建音乐和视频流媒体应用程序。

深圳实时数据API挖掘,API数据

API数据是指通过应用程序接口(API)获取的数据。API是一种允许不同软件应用程序之间相互通信和交换数据的方式。当我们使用API来请求数据时,API会返回相应的数据,这些数据可以是文本、数字、图像、音频或其他形式的信息。API数据可以来自各种来源,例如社交媒体平台、天气预报服务、地图服务、金融数据提供商等。通过API,开发人员可以从这些服务中获取特定的数据,以便在自己的应用程序中使用。API数据通常以结构化的格式返回,例如JSON(JavaScript Object Notation)或XML(eXtensible Markup Language)。这些格式使得数据易于解析和处理。开发人员可以使用编程语言(如Python、Java、JavaScript等)来调用API,并处理返回的数据,以便在自己的应用程序中显示、分析或处理。开发人员使用API数据集成地理位置和地图功能到应用程序中。深圳实时数据API挖掘

API数据用于创建教育和学习应用程序,提供在线学习资源。深圳实时数据API挖掘

处理API数据中的数据同步和异步通信是根据具体需求和系统设计来确定的。下面是两种常见的处理方式:数据同步通信:在数据同步通信中,API请求和响应是同步进行的,即请求方发送请求后,会一直等待直到接收到响应。这种通信方式适用于需要立即获取结果或依赖前一步操作结果的情况。在数据同步通信中,请求方发送请求后,会暂时阻塞并等待服务器的响应,一旦收到响应,请求方才能继续执行后续操作。这种方式相对简单直接,但可能会导致请求方的等待时间较长,特别是在处理大量请求或请求响应时间较长的情况下。异步通信:在异步通信中,API请求和响应是异步进行的,即请求方发送请求后,不需要立即等待响应,而是可以继续执行其他操作。服务器在接收到请求后,会立即返回一个确认或响应接收的消息,然后在后台进行处理,并将然后结果发送给请求方。这种通信方式适用于不需要立即获取结果或需要处理大量请求的情况。在异步通信中,请求方可以通过回调函数、轮询或使用消息队列等方式来获取然后的响应结果。这种方式可以提高系统的并发性和响应性,但需要额外的机制来处理异步的响应和结果获取。深圳实时数据API挖掘

信息来源于互联网 本站不为信息真实性负责